The NVSD’s  Digital Media Academy and DMA Lite is a mini school program based at Argyle. It is a specialty program for students who are focused on animation, film, visual effects, graphic design, sound engineering, programming, robotics, photography and web design.  The DMA program is an enriched hands-on program that provides students with access to a broad and useful range of skills and knowledge in digital design, technology, project management and problem solving.  

  • The Digital Media Lite Academy takes place during block 4 on day one.  This is one class that is specifically for Grade 9 and 10 students and is open to all students across the North Vancouver School District.
  • The Digital Media FULL Academy is during Block 1, 2 and 3 and takes place on day one of the school calendar.  This is for Grade 11 and 12 students and is open to all students across the North Vancouver School District.  Block 4 would be an additional ‘academic’ block where students would resume at their home school.

DMA & DMA Lite incorporates STEAM in the curriculum which has enhanced the learning of the program as one of the main goals of the Digital Media Academy is to prepare students for post-secondary training and the many career opportunities in Digital Media, Science, Technology and Engineering.

Upon completion of the DMA program, students will have a portfolio of work for their post-secondary requirements.
